Transaction 30b7d60d6665d8c7e48f2ead423870106bd98d66234e500c045744f87a55cd35
1 Input
1 Output
-
30b7d60d6665d8c7e48f2ead423870106bd98d66234e500c045744f87a55cd35:0
- value
- 1587921
- script pubkey
- OP_0 OP_PUSHBYTES_32 7b57c8f2fdbb84ea40a73a1e49f99c281385424c32e552cdff9ec3a83cc388cb
- address
- bc1q0dtu3uhahwzw5s988g0yn7vu9qfc2sjvxtj49n0lnmp6s0xr3r9sawd0v9